Kwajalein Pipefish and their Relatives

This page covers some members of the families Sygnathidae (pipefish and seahorses), Solenostomidae (ghost pipefish) and Pegasidae (sea moths) found at Kwajalein. This is not a complete list, since we have not yet seen several species known to occur in the Marshalls. Also, the identifications are by no means certain. The animals are difficult to positively identify, and the various books we referenced do not appear to agree on all the names. These references are listed at the bottom of this page.
